Quarterly Planning Note – Lumenpath Software

Heads up, everyone: we're greenlighting the "Atlas" subscription tier for next quarter. It sits between Core and Enterprise, bundling the new Skylark analytics module at a mid-range price point. Marketing drafts land in two weeks; support staffing needs a plan from each department. Mr. Herrick owns the launch timeline. Our confidential positioning note is included directly below.

management briefing: The renewal with Oliixek Group closes at $10 million a year, 5 percent below the last contract. Project Holix slips by one quarter because of the tooling delay.

**Ticket LIFT-208 — Expired creds for dispatch sim**

Heads up for release: the Vertica elevator-dispatch simulator can't pull building profiles anymore because its service credential expired Tuesday. That blocks the pre-release regression run for the Marrow Tower scenario pack. Nothing wrong with the sim itself — just swap the credential and rerun. Platform team already issued a replacement; the new key is below.

API key for yahig-tadup: kto7_ubizbYm

**14:22 — Stale-cache bug confirmed.** The Glimmerhook plugin host was serving cached manifests past their expiry, so plugins built against schema v7 received v6 responses. Plugin authors who shipped workarounds during this window should remove them before the next review cycle. The affected host build is identified by the token below.

pipeline stamp: htk9_ce63042d9